Pairing fables with similarities encourages kids to make connections. Consider pairing these fables. To help them find similarities, use the Venn diagram.
Similar Characterization
- Fable Pair 1 - “The Ants and the Grasshopper” and “The Tortoise and the Hare” – The Grasshopper and the Hare are carefree; the Ants and the Tortoise are industrious. The Grasshopper and the Hare learn similar lessons.
- Fable Pair 2 - ”The Peacock” and “The Town Mouse and the Country Mouse” – The Peacock and the Town Mouse both wish for something they don’t have. It doesn’t turn out well for either one of them in the end.
